The shift to is where the game truly shines. In most tower defense titles, "multiplayer" is an afterthought or a simple co-op mode. In Element TD 2 , the competitive "War Mode" introduces a layer of psychological warfare. Players don't just defend their own paths; they must balance their economy between building defenses and sending "creeps" to overwhelm their opponents. This creates a fascinating tension: do you spend your gold on a stronger tower to survive the next wave, or do you invest in a massive rush to knock out your rival before they can stabilize? Unlike traditional tower defense games where you simply upgrade a basic unit, Element TD 2 requires players to unlock specific elemental combinations to create "Dual" or "Triple" towers. For example, combining Water and Earth might give you a slowing tower, while Fire and Nature could result in high area-of-effect damage. Because players are limited in how many elemental "essences" they can pick per match, no two games ever play out the same way. You aren't just building towers; you are drafting a specialized army. The tower defense genre is often criticized for being "solvable"—once a player discovers the strongest unit, the challenge disappears. However, Element TD 2 avoids this trap by centering its entire gameplay loop around a complex, six-element synergy system.
